Tragedy 15 minutes before the New Year. Olympian dies in horrific crash
Bekzat Sattarkhanov / Photo: © Thierry Orban / Contributor / Getty Images Sport / Gettyimages.ru
The star athlete said goodbye to his mother and was already rushing to his friends, but … he died under strange circumstances.
Boxer Bekzat Sattarkhanov by the age of 20 established himself in the status of a national star. In just five years, he went from a beginner in boxing to an Olympic champion. Victory at the Sydney Games in 2000 made him a hero of the country. He was supposed to live an excellent life and bring more success to Kazakhstani sports, but the tragedy that happened 15 minutes before the New Year changed everything.
The boxer’s father believed that the accident that his son had had could not have been accidental.
15 km on foot and chasing a dream
Bekzat spent a difficult childhood in his native Turkestan. It could not be otherwise, because his growing up took place against the backdrop of the collapse of the Soviet Union with all the ensuing consequences. The time was, to put it mildly, not rich. All the good that was left of the USSR evaporated, but a lot of problems appeared, high crime and much more. Sattarkhanov’s parents were rather poor, so Bekzat dreamed of getting out of this situation and arranging a comfortable and happy life for his family.
Largely because of this, he decided to become a boxer, and he did it very late. He was 15 years old when he chased his dream. He wanted to see new countries, learn the culture of other people and develop both personally and professionally. For this, he got up every morning at 5 am and covered a distance of 15 kilometers to the training hall. Often he did not have enough money for the bus, so the guy just walked or took a morning jog. Although, given the distance, it would be more correct to call it a half marathon.
Sattarkhanov loved justice since childhood and always stood up for girls when he saw that they were offended. He didn’t care that they were physically stronger and older than him. Therefore, it is not surprising that he chose boxing as his sports career. In the 10th grade, Bekzat was invited to the city of Shymkent, located 150 kilometers from his native Turkestan. There was an Olympian training school, which was simply necessary to continue development. Of course, it was not easy for him to leave his parental home, friends, but there was no doubt about the correctness of the decision. To become what he wanted, he just had to do it.
Around the same years, Bekzat’s talent as a singer erupted. He superbly performed songs with a guitar and, according to eyewitnesses, could look worthy on the stage. The girls, of course, liked all this very much, but Sattarkhanov did not even think about becoming an artist. It was just a hobby that he was great at. All thoughts were connected with boxing and only with it.
Fast flight to the top and crazy Olympic gold
Bekzat only had two years of training to qualify for the youth team of Kazakhstan in the featherweight division. It was fantastic progress. And in 1998, he was already on the podium of the World Youth Championship in Buenos Aires. Shortly thereafter, the selection for the Olympic Games in Sydney took place. In order to win the coveted ticket, Sattarkhanov needed to defeat an opponent from Ukraine. The fight was incredibly difficult, Bekzat left the ring covered in blood, but still won and qualified for the 2000 Games.
He certainly was not the favorite of that Olympics. Experts viewed him as a star of the future, not the present. But Bekzat was sure that there was no point in waiting for the next Olympic cycle, because if you made it to the main start of the four years, the result must be given here and now. As if he felt that there would be no other chance. Even at a meeting with his teacher at school shortly before his trip to Sydney, he signed a card for her with the words: “With love and gratitude, Olympic champion Bekzat Sattarkhanov.”
He truly believed that Olympic gold was real and achievable. In Australia, the most difficult fight for him was the quarterfinal with the Turkish boxer Ramzan Paliani. The thing is that the Turkish delegation really wanted a medal in this type of program and put pressure on the judges in every possible way so that they did everything right. However, Vice-President of the International Boxing Federation Beket Makhmutov came to the aid of Sattarkhanov. Tom managed to “settle down” the work of the judiciary, and Sattarkhanov won a well-deserved victory.
In the semifinals and finals, he confidently dealt with his rivals and became the Olympic champion for the first and last time. Bekzat at home immediately became a star of the national level. He was personally congratulated by the President of Kazakhstan and presented with a state order. Nevertheless, the fallen fame did not change him. Meeting with officials and celebrities, he perceived as part of the job and still tried to spend as much time as possible with friends and family.
The secret of death. Did you set up an accident?
On December 31, 2000, Sattarkhanov took part in a solemn event on the main square of Turkestan, where he was awarded the “Athlete of the Year in Kazakhstan” award. Then there was a warm meeting with the family, hugs with mom. No one knew that it was, in fact, a farewell. Bekzat set off on the road two hours before the New Year. He had to drive 150 kilometers by car to Shymkent, where friends and a festive table were waiting for him. And he went on an expensive car, which he bought with prize money for winning the Olympics.
However, Bekzat did not reach the place of celebration. Before the destination was 40 kilometers, when the car flew to the side of the road and rolled over. There were two more people in the car with the champion, they both survived, but Sattarkhanov died on the spot. There were 15 minutes left before the New Year. The athlete’s father, a few years after the tragedy, in an interview with Azattyk radio, suggested that the true circumstances of death could differ from the simple “lost control.”
– There are some doubts in my soul, but again, I can’t say for sure and say something for sure. Perhaps Bekzat was destined to die this way. Nobody saw it, and whoever saw it, for some reason, does not tell the truth. Now no one is raising this issue. Sometimes it seems to me that in this way everything will be forgotten in time. And after Bekzat, more eminent athletes died under mysterious circumstances. But even these tragedies are not disclosed,” said Seilkhan Sattarkhanov.
The father of the Olympic champion is probably hinting at the rumors that were circulating in Kazakhstan. Allegedly, the accident was set up by bandits, with whom Bekzat did not want to share the prize money. The silence of the witnesses really looked strange, but no one ever found any evidence. The death of a remarkable boxer will forever remain a mystery.

“The grappling match with Makhachev will not take place, because Islam earns a lot of money in the UFC” – Tsarukyan
UFC lightweight number one Arman Tsarukyan said that he does not yet consider a potential grappling fight with the promotion’s welterweight champion Islam Makhachev to be realistic.
On Tuesday, Tsarukyan and Sharabutdin Magomedov, known by his nickname Shara Bullet, ended in a draw in a grappling bout in Yerevan.
— The grappling match with Makhachev will not take place, because Islam earns a lot of money in the UFC. I don’t think anyone can afford to pay him that amount,” Red Corner MMA quotes Tsarukyan as saying.

TYSON FURY: “Usyk will give up his champion title and there is a reason for that”
Former world heavyweight champion, British Tyson Rage I am sure that WBC champion Oleksandr Usyk will leave his belt vacant due to the lack of interesting opponents:
“Usyk will not fight opponents ranked in the WBC because it is impossible to make good money from these fights. How much money will he make by fighting Agit Kabayel or Lawrence Okolie?”
Frankly, these are insufficient. After making a ton of money fighting Tyson Fury, you don’t want to go back to fights that have no financial benefit.
Usik will therefore give up his WBC title and Agit Kabayel will become the full world champion. He will be able to defend against (German boxer) Okolie or Moses Itauma,” Fury said on the DAZN platform.
Kabayel’s next opponent will be Poland’s undefeated representative Damian Knyba. The fight for the WBC interim title will take place in Germany on January 10.

Joshua, injured in the accident, will spend New Year’s Eve in a Nigerian hospital
Anthony Joshua / Photo: © Richard Pelham / Stringer / Getty Images Sport / Gettyimages.ru
Former WBA, WBO, IBF heavyweight world champion Briton Anthony Joshua will spend New Year’s Eve in one of the best hospitals in Nigeria, continuing to recover from a car accident, reports the Daily Mail.
The incident occurred on Monday along the Lagos-Ibadan Expressway. The Lexus SUV Joshua was in collided with a stationary truck. According to the preliminary version of the investigation, the accident occurred due to a burst tire when the Lexus exceeded the speed limit on this section of the road. In addition to Joshua and the driver, there were also two people in the car who died on the spot.
Local police said Joshua was in a “stable” condition and had only suffered “minor” injuries, although there were concerns they could be more serious than previously reported. So Joshua will remain in the hospital for at least a couple more days as he continues to recover.
At the hospital, the boxer occupies the “royal suite”. Here, patients receive personalized care 24 hours a day and have access to medical and front desk staff. They also receive gourmet meals from the kitchen, prepared to suit their tastes.
Olympic champion Joshua defeated American blogger Jake Paul in a fight in Miami on December 19. In total, he has 29 victories and four defeats in the professional ring.
